1

Free listing Fundamentals Explained

News Discuss 
WebsiteSetup.org is actually a free resource internet site for encouraging men and women to generate, customize and boost their websites. As translation is the topic of enhancement so chances are you'll discover some inappropriate words in translation. It will probably be great in the event you aid us to enhance https://www.domains-website-app-center.store/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story